Bughdasheni Lake (Шаблон:Lang-ka) is a volcanic lake[1] in the Ninotsminda Municipality, Samtskhe–Javakheti region of Georgia.[2] located in Javakheti Plateau, at 2040 m above sea level.[1] The area of surface is 0.39 km², while the catchment area is 69.3 km². Average depth is 0.42 m, maximal depth is 0.85 m.[1] Gets its feed from snow, rainfall and underground waters. High water levels at spring, low at autumn. Much of the southern part of this area consists of wetlands.[3] The river Bughdasheni (left-bank tributary of the Paravani) flows out of the lake. The lake is rich in fish, including trout.[4] The area around the lake is home for part of the year to many species of migratory birds and the shore largely pristine and undisturbed.[5] Bughdasheni Lake is the part of Bugdasheni Managed Reserve. Since 2020 it has been designated as a Ramsar site.[6]
